Ktm 690 Duke 13 MOT Data by Registration Year
Full breakdown of pass rate and mileage for each year. Use this to compare the Ktm 690 Duke 13 year you're looking at.
| Year | Tests | Pass Rate | Low Mi. | Typical Mi. | High Mi. |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2013 | 784 | 88.3% | 5,882 | 9,274 | 13,808 |

How Does the Ktm 690 Duke 13 Compare?
MOT pass rates compared to similar models. Click any model for the full breakdown.
| Model | Pass Rate | Tests | Typical Mileage | Lifespan |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Ktm 690 Duke 13 THIS CAR | 88.5% | 809 | 9,255 mi | 13 yrs |
| Ktm 125 | 76.8% | 13,595 | 10,169 mi | 21 yrs |
| Ktm 950 | 86.8% | 11,776 | 15,596 mi | 23 yrs |
| Ktm 640 LC4-E | 83.6% | 9,903 | 8,082 mi | 27 yrs |
| Honda CD125T | 78.9% | 1,096 | 23,772 mi | 44 yrs |
Compared to the Ktm 125 (76.8% pass rate) and the Ktm 950 (86.8% pass rate), the Ktm 690 Duke 13 outperforms both on MOT reliability.

The Ktm 690 Duke 13 has an overall MOT pass rate of 88.5% across 809 real MOT tests — comfortably above the UK average, which puts it among the more reliable models on UK roads.
The most common failure point is headlamp aim too high with 2 recorded occurrences. Check for this on any test drive or pre-purchase inspection.
On the safety side, the most frequently flagged dangerous fault is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m. Dangerous faults cause an immediate MOT failure and mean the vehicle is not roadworthy until repaired. If you're viewing a Ktm 690 Duke 13 with an expired or recently passed MOT, ask the seller whether any dangerous faults were found and fixed during the last test.
A typical Ktm 690 Duke 13 owner drives around 588 miles per year. If the car you're looking at is significantly above this, expect more wear on suspension, brakes and tyres. If it's well below, the vehicle may have been sitting unused — check for perished rubber, corroded discs and stale fluids.
